Photograph of a 1927 painting of the ship Noonday, William Henry, artist. The Noonday was built in 1855 at the Fernald & Petigrew Shipyard, Portsmouth, NH. She made three successful round-trip passages from the east coast to the west coast. On her fourth voyage, however, she struck an uncharted rock near the entrance to San Francisco harbor. Noonday sank on January 1, 1863. All hands were saved. |
